HAZARD RATING FOR YOUR FACILITY: Low (≤15) Total Score = 14
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
401 - Adequate handwashing stations not available for employees [s. 21(4)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Hand washing sink had a flat of eggs covering half of the sink and a full pitcher of water stored inside of it.
Corrective Action(s): Ensure that the hand washing sink is not obstructed at any time during food service operations.
Violation Score: 5

Non-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
304 - Premises not free of pests [s. 26(a)]
Observation: Droppings found on the floor near the back door of the kitchen. Two dead mice found in the mouse trap kept underneath the stand up coolers next to the office area. The last pest control report was from November 30, 2017. This is not often enough.
Corrective Action(s): Clean all droppings and have pest control come on site within one week and provide the report.
Violation Score: 9
